Luella Spring/Summer 2010

I loved Luella’s Spring/Summer 2010 collection! It was like a fusion between Amy Winehouse and the Stepford Wives!

It was big bows, big hair, prim accessories, bold eyes, 50s inspired dresses and suits, polka dots and mad hats- similar to old fashioned swimming caps!

HEMYCA

When I saw that HEMYCAs Autumn Winter 2009 collection was inspired by the Venetian architecture I knew I would love it. Venice has to be one of my most favourite places in the world, expensive yes it is, full of tourist yes I know but there is a certain magic quality about it that makes it truly breathtaking. I totally agree with Luigi Barzini of the New York times when he said it is “undoubtedly the most beautiful city built by man”.

Anyway, moving on, the A/W collection is stunning, beautifully constructed and look like they would flatter any womanly figure. The lace and leather add a bit of sex, and although I am not a big fan of maxi dresses or long skirts in general but I have fallen for the long red satin skirt paired with the lace top. A sophisticated alternative to the usual red carpet gaudy glitz. Similarly I really enjoy the long pvc gloves, a nice hint of S&M that will liven up any outfit!

Made Her Think

Recently came across this amazing jewellery designer called Made Her Think.
The pieces are dark and imaginative mixing strong symbolism with delicate stones and detailing. What’s more many of the pieces come in several different materials, mostly gun metal, silver or gold.

As far as I can see Made Her Think is only available in the US, fingers crossed they will be in the UK soon.
